Plage du Débarcadère, literally 'Landing Beach,' is Mayumba's most urban and accessible stretch of coastline. Located right by the town's main landing area, this beach buzzes with a unique energy, a blend of daily commerce and casual relaxation. Here, the ocean isn't just a backdrop; it's an integral part of the community's rhythm, from fishing boats coming and going to children playing in the shallows. The sand, soft and inviting, offers a quick escape from the nearby town, yet you're never far from the local pulse. You'll see fishermen mending nets, vendors selling fresh produce, and families enjoying the cool ocean breeze. It’s a place to observe, to connect, and to feel the authentic spirit of Mayumba without venturing far from amenities. As the day winds down, Plage du Débarcadère becomes a popular spot for sunset viewing. The sky transforms into a canvas of warm colors, reflecting on the gentle waves, creating a picturesque scene that locals and visitors alike gather to appreciate. It's a convenient, friendly, and genuinely Mayumban beach experience, perfect for those seeking an easy, engaging coastal encounter.
